Okay. You're asking a lot here, but I'll do my best. All of Apocalypse's tech is based on that given to him by the Celestials. He used this tech to transform Angel into his Horseman, Death. This involved grafting on metal wings, turing his skin blue, brain-washing, etc. Warren was ultimately able to resist Apocalypse's influence, but he remained physically altered. Then, through unexplained circumstance, Warren's body changed further, the wings became feathered again and he gained a secondary mutation of a healing touch. Then, Warren realized that he still possessed aspects of the Death persona Apocalypse had engendered in him way back when. He gained the ability to transform back and forth from his original feathered-wing form to his blue-skinned, metal-winged form. Every time he made this transformation, the Death persona gained a greater and greater grasp on his overall psyche - until it finally took over and this led to the Dark Angel Saga in Uncanny X-Force. There, Betsy was forced to kill Warren by stabbing him with the life-seed (also Celestial Tech). This killed him, but also recreated his body (albeit with a blanked mind). The new body the life-seed created was sort of a mix between Angel's two forms (caucasian skin but metal wings).
Warren's original personality has been erased so it stands to reason that the death persona has been deleted as well.
Whether or not the Death persona will ever return waits to be seen - but with the cyclical nature of comic stories, I'd venture to say that it probably will.
